Verdict: CaseIH 4494 vs CaseIH Magnum 215

The CaseIH 4494 and the CaseIH Magnum 215 are both tractors — here is how they stack up on the figures that matter. CaseIH Magnum 215 leads on rated power with 178 hp against 175 hp. CaseIH 4494 is the lighter machine (9,453 kg vs 20,100 kg), which helps on soft ground and transport, while the heavier model carries more ballast for traction-limited draft work. CaseIH Magnum 215 is the newer design (2008 vs 1984). In short: choose the CaseIH Magnum 215 for outright pulling power, or the CaseIH 4494 if a tighter budget and lighter footprint matter more.
